Since 2005, AKKUR LLC has been manufacturing electrical cables using the latest automated European technologies and a fully equipped testing laboratory meeting national certification standards.
Every cable production stage, from raw material (99.9% pure copper) reception to high voltage testing of the finished cable, undergoes strict engineering supervision.
Electrolytic copper rods are drawn on modern machinery down to any required diameter (e.g. 0.15 mm to 3.2 mm).
Fine copper wires are stranded into conductors and coated with premium PVC/XLPE insulation layer in extrusion lines.
Cables are armored with steel wires and coated with durable PVC/LSZH outer sheathing for environmental protection.
Every cable we manufacture undergoes physical, chemical, and electrical testing in our laboratory. We guarantee 100% quality and safety.
The electrical conductivity and elasticity degrees of 99.9% pure electrolytic copper wires used in cables are tested.
The dielectric strength of the cables' insulation layer is tested under high voltage to completely prevent leakage.
Fire-resistant cables are tested for flame propagation, toxic gas emission, and smoke density under extreme temperatures.
